I left out the "X".  The proper model number is CMX300.

Doing a google search turns up tons of pages...the first of which is:
http://www.mdiusa.com/cgi-local/SoftCart.exe/best_cmx300.htm?E+scstore

Where it is for sale under $80.

Searching on Pricewatch for CMX300 shows one entry at $73.  Last I looked, 
it was on the shelves in almost all CompUSA's, and MicroCenter.  White and 
blue box.  The modem itself is beige, thin and flat.  It comes with a stand 
for vertical positioning if you like.

Mine has never once hicoughed.  After tuning my TCP settings on my 
computer, I am getting better than 1.6 Mbps most of the time.
